I used 1 can to do the bit behind the number plate and the bottom lip and there wasn't much left in the can. I did put 3 coats on it though so buy two.

The cans are £9 each but delivery is the expensive part so buy two to begin with so postage should be combined

Hi,

Thought about plasti-dipping my front end the same as you have. Looking online though it appears it can come out quite "mottled"/"bumpy" wiould prefer a satin smooth finish personally.

Do you think the pics I've seen are just ill prepped or spraying too thick/close?

It wasnt totally smooth but close enough. Like mentioned above, thin coats and this will get it as smooth as possible.

I no longer have the car any more and have since got a FL Cupra which as the part next to the number plate done in a GLOSS black.

I want to do the lip again but PlastiDip wont do the job this time :( as it will come out satin Black / Grey type colour.
